Black Hebrew Israelites
I have run into this religious group around five times over the past few years, and I have received a shotgun blast of proof text coming from its street priests. For the sake of brevity, I will not be able to state everything they believe, and that is not my goal here. It is my goal to share how the BLT of James Cone is going to fan the flames of the BHI.
Here is the cliff notes version of what these chaps believe. They believe they are of the pure race of the Israelites and whites are the Edomites. We are the descendants of Esau. I am not kidding you; this is what they believe. We cannot be saved, but only warned of coming judgment. The pure nation of Israel –which they believe is the black race- is the only group that can be saved.
In a similar way, James Cone states, “Only the oppressed know what is wrong, because they are both the victims of evil and the recipients of God’s liberating activity.”[1] This quote and the thought that only the oppressed can be liberated because they are the victims of evil is the tip of the iceberg with Cone. Sin cannot be addressed from outside of the black community because sin is determined by the community. This is playing right into the hands of BHI.

Black Liberation Theology- Ethnic Gnosticism-Standpoint Epistemology
I touched on this earlier and will elaborate just a bit. Ethnic Gnosticism runs amuck in BLT. Gnosticism was a movement that was around during biblical times with adherents who claimed to have secret knowledge about God. You had to become a part of the sect in order to have this knowledge transmitted to you. Gnosticism is still here today, just in different forms. Whenever some of a specific ethnic group has a secret insight on the straightforward text of Scripture there is an issue, and we drift from sound biblical theology to satanic theology.
Standpoint epistemology suffers from the same curse that ethnic Gnosticism does. It puts a specific group in the driver’s seat rather than the revelation of the Word of God explained through biblical theology.
